I have tried two types from Timberbits (Timberbits.com) in Sydney. One type fits in the standard slimline kit I think. I would steer well away from these (told so by Timberbits and backed up by own experience). They work but break easily. The second type replaces a Parker refill. These seem to work quite well but the action of advancing and retracting the lead is not that intuitive. It relies on the normal twist that would advance and retract the pen. But twisting one way unlocks and advances the lead, while twisting the other way locks the lead in place (while appearing to do nothing).
